gpt4 book ai didi

python - 如何使用 xlwings 保存工作簿?

转载 作者:太空狗 更新时间:2023-10-29 21:39:46 25 4
gpt4 key购买 nike

我有一个 Excel 工作表、一些按钮和一些宏。我使用 xlwings 让它工作。有没有办法通过 xlwings 保存工作簿?我想在操作后提取特定的工作表,但保存的工作表是操作前提取的工作表,没有生成数据。

我提取我需要的工作表的代码如下:

Set objFSO = CreateObject("Scripting.FileSystemObject")

src_file = objFSO.GetAbsolutePathName(Wscript.Arguments.Item(0))
sheet_name = Wscript.Arguments.Item(1)
dir_name = Wscript.Arguments.Item(2)
file_name = Wscript.Arguments.Item(3)

Dim objExcel
Set objExcel = CreateObject("Excel.Application")
objExcel.Visible = False

Dim objWorkbook
Set objWorkbook = objExcel.Workbooks(src_file)

objWorkbook.Sheets(sheet_name).Copy
objExcel.DisplayAlerts = False

objExcel.ActiveWorkbook.SaveAs dir_name + file_name + ".xlsx", 51
objExcel.ActiveWorkbook.SaveAs dir_name + file_name + ".csv", 6

objWorkbook.Close False
objExcel.Quit

最佳答案

Book.save() 现已实现:参见 docs .

关于python - 如何使用 xlwings 保存工作簿?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/27281914/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com